Which one is it? In the south corner, with the asymmetric leaf base elms have, one side of the leaf starting lower on the stalk than the other.

The register says two things about this tree and both are worth having. It is the oldest elm in Tilburg, and it was already standing before the park was laid out around it. That second fact is the interesting one. A park built around an existing tree is a different object from a park planted from nothing: somebody stood on this ground, looked at what was here, and drew the paths to keep it. The elm was the reason for a decision rather than the result of one. Being the oldest elm anywhere in the Netherlands is a harder thing than it sounds. Dutch elm disease arrived here in the 1920s and the second, far more aggressive strain in the 1970s, and between them they killed most of the mature elms in the country. Whole avenues went. An elm that reached a century and a half through both waves did so partly by luck of position, standing alone in a park corner rather than in a line where the beetles could work along it. It is in the south corner. Elms leaf late and hold on late, so in November it is often still green when the rest of the park has turned.

Species
Dutch Elm (Ulmus x hollandica)
Age estimate
roughly 145 to 155 years, from the register's planting band of 1870 to 1880
Location
Wilhelminapark, in the south corner of the park (Wilhelminapark)
Access
Free. Public park, open daily.
Getting there
About 1.5 km north of Tilburg station, on foot.
